Lines Matching defs:StreamVal

547   /// Check that the stream (in StreamVal) is not NULL.
551 ProgramStateRef ensureStreamNonNull(SVal StreamVal, const Expr *StreamE,
558 ProgramStateRef ensureStreamOpened(SVal StreamVal, CheckerContext &C,
568 ensureNoFilePositionIndeterminate(SVal StreamVal, CheckerContext &C,
979 std::optional<DefinedSVal> StreamVal =
981 if (!StreamVal)
984 SymbolRef StreamSym = StreamVal->getAsSymbol();
999 State->BindExpr(CE, C.getLocationContext(), *StreamVal);
1036 SVal StreamVal = getStreamArg(Desc, Call);
1037 State = ensureStreamNonNull(StreamVal, Call.getArgExpr(Desc->StreamArgNo), C,
1041 State = ensureStreamOpened(StreamVal, C, State);
1044 State = ensureNoFilePositionIndeterminate(StreamVal, C, State);
1048 SymbolRef Sym = StreamVal.getAsSymbol();
1061 SVal StreamVal = getStreamArg(Desc, Call);
1062 State = ensureStreamNonNull(StreamVal, Call.getArgExpr(Desc->StreamArgNo), C,
1066 State = ensureStreamOpened(StreamVal, C, State);
1069 State = ensureNoFilePositionIndeterminate(StreamVal, C, State);
1506 SVal StreamVal = getStreamArg(Desc, Call);
1507 State = ensureStreamNonNull(StreamVal, Call.getArgExpr(Desc->StreamArgNo), C,
1511 State = ensureStreamOpened(StreamVal, C, State);
1636 SVal StreamVal = getStreamArg(Desc, Call);
1637 std::optional<DefinedSVal> Stream = StreamVal.getAs<DefinedSVal>();
1645 ensureStreamOpened(StreamVal, C, StateNotNull);
1651 SVal StreamVal = getStreamArg(Desc, Call);
1652 std::optional<DefinedSVal> Stream = StreamVal.getAs<DefinedSVal>();
1688 if (SymbolRef StreamSym = StreamVal.getAsSymbol()) {
1784 SVal StreamVal = getStreamArg(Desc, Call);
1785 State = ensureStreamNonNull(StreamVal, Call.getArgExpr(Desc->StreamArgNo), C,
1789 State = ensureStreamOpened(StreamVal, C, State);
1812 StreamChecker::ensureStreamNonNull(SVal StreamVal, const Expr *StreamE,
1815 auto Stream = StreamVal.getAs<DefinedSVal>();
1878 ProgramStateRef StreamChecker::ensureStreamOpened(SVal StreamVal,
1881 SymbolRef Sym = StreamVal.getAsSymbol();
1924 SVal StreamVal, CheckerContext &C, ProgramStateRef State) const {
1930 SymbolRef Sym = StreamVal.getAsSymbol();